Just wondering if anyone is even remotely familiar with the "Seckatary Hawkins" books written by Robert Schulkers? They are about a fictional boys riverside club in early/mid last century - adventure/mystery books for kids. These were originally serialized in newspapers, and then published in book form over a period of years.
There are at least a couple of the books out of copyright, but I was only able to find one online: http://www.archive.org/details/redrunners00schuiala That being said, they are probably more of a locally known series (and by collectors who grew up reading them ~ the books can go for a pretty penny )

It looks like the Red Runners is the only one out of copywrite, but a bunch of them will be PD in a few years -
The Red Runners (1922)
Seckatary Hawkins in Cuba (1925)
Stormie The Dog Stealer (1925)
Stoner's Boy (1926)
The Gray Ghost (1926)
Knights of the Square Table (1926)
Ching Toy (1926)
The Chinese Coin (1926)
The Yellow Y (1926)
Herman the Fiddler (1930)
The Ghost of Lake Tapaho (1932)

Actually, the "Seckatary Hawkins in Cuba" was originally published in 1921. I have seen the later date as well, but I have a copy and it says 1921. Chronologically it comes before "The Red Runners".
The problem is finding scans. Hathi does have one that will be PD next year.
